No, it's currently set to the nophead's default of 200*16/1. 200 steps per revolution, 1/16th microstepping, 1mm per revolution of the M6 threaded rod.Quote

Check your firmware for steps per mm on the Z axis. If this is not a whole number it may be the reason you're getting inconsistent results. Try the test again with a whole-number multiple of the steps per mm setting.
The couplers are printed as part of nophead's design. They are pairs of these that sandwich the threaded rod and motor shaft. The motor shaft currently is cushioned to allow for some alignment inaccuracies by tight fitting nylon tubing. I actually have some replacement lead screws, nuts, and real couplings coming from Misumi in the next day or two as part of their free $150 promo. I guess that could be it, but it seemed to repeatable. If it twist flexes in one way, why not the other? Or why does the problem seem linear the farther I travel the more it's off when it returns? I'd think a twisting flex issue would show the same error margin whether it traveled 10mm or 30mm.Quote
